When you start a business, having a vision for the end goal iscrucial. It is within this vision that a structure will be built tomaintain assets and provide avenues for growth. Tax laws can bothhelp or hinder your business, and it is often too difficult tonavigate this labyrinth on your own, especially since the ruleschange every year, state by state. While corporations, LLC’s, andmore complicated structures are notoriously complex, even asole-proprietorship will benefit from having all the i’s dotted andthe t’s crossed according to the government under which it stands.A CPA can help keep your records in order, and a tax attorney canadvise you in the most profitable direction for your company.
